Output 290174db7f2e0c24db569e47f98fbf53b14c3f4b1efbc0d62dcc4a498f4fbfb7:1

value
12267562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374f941b109b8a76124ab77367ae7e53417c5 OP_EQUAL
address
3BMEXNQY2dRNCKo1pvx4BZ4eUPmdAkzZw4
transaction
290174db7f2e0c24db569e47f98fbf53b14c3f4b1efbc0d62dcc4a498f4fbfb7
confirmations
362244
spent
true